Output 95615165286c445d82b98b090f7fcfa1063518b87510d8a2e400828ad438796f:0

value
11661808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c789b61665fa4b6eee2d9940bdba6e962c61e4 OP_EQUAL
address
3CcMNWZ1E4hCfMRjqAGibgmQ9LQBHiXk6Y
transaction
95615165286c445d82b98b090f7fcfa1063518b87510d8a2e400828ad438796f